Release checklist item for the Fernhaven greenhouse controller, v3 line. Support should know that this release includes the sensor drift compensation patch: humidity probes older than two seasons were reading up to 6% high, causing over-venting in warm weeks. The firmware now recalibrates nightly against the reference probe. If a customer still reports drift after updating, confirm the reference probe is seated and collect a diagnostic export. When escalating, always include the firmware build identifier printed below.

trace token, fafog-kageg: htk4_98e6

The Graphlet API renders dependency graphs for anything in the Mosshaven monorepo — just POST a manifest and you get back a layout JSON you can feed into the viewer. Rate limits are generous, so don't stress about batching early on. Every request needs to be authenticated against the internal Graphlet service, though, so before your first call, grab the key provided below.

service key, kaduf-bawig: kto15_Ze79S0dligTw0yO

**Alert: DeployParrot unresponsive**

DeployParrot is the chat bot that posts deploy status to the release channel. This alert fires when it misses two consecutive heartbeats. Usually the webhook relay is stuck; restarting the relay pod clears it. Do not restart the bot itself first — that drops queued deploy notifications. Deploys continue fine without the bot; this is informational, not blocking. As a contractor you won't have prod access, so page the platform rotation. Triage steps are here.

runbook for badug-kadup: https://confluence.zemvarlabs.internal/projects/browse/display/projects/bd1b

Handover Note — Customer Support Outsourcing

Welcome aboard. The key open item is the plan to outsource tier-one support to Calderro Services, covering evenings and weekends first, then full coverage by Q4. Contract terms are drafted but unsigned; quality metrics and the escalation path still need your review. Internal comms are sensitive — the Fenwick team has not yet been briefed on role changes. Mira's transition plan is solid but timing is yours to call. The underlying business rationale follows directly below.

management briefing: Project Ulavan slips by two quarters because of the staffing delay.